Craig Parker 

 
Craig Parker plays the Roman Legatus Claudius Glaber in “Spartacus: Blood and Sand,” the Starz original action adventure drama series. Glaber blames Spartacus for his failed military campaign and plots against him. Married to Ilithyia, the spoiled daughter of a wealthy and powerful Senator, Glaber aims for greatness without the ability to achieve it.

A New Zealander born in Fiji, Parker was 17 when he started work in New Zealand television on the hit series “Gloss,” followed by roles in several dramas, including “Gold” and “City Life” and four years as the popular Guy Warner on the soap “Shortland Street.” His international work began with “Spartacus: Blood and Sand” executive producers Rob Tapert and Sam Raimi’s “Xena: Warrior Princess” and “Young Hercules” and includes Disney’s “Power Rangers.” He recently starred as the villain Darken Rahl in Tapert and Raimi’s “The Legend of the Seeker.” Parker is equally at home in comedy, and was seen most recently in “Diplomatic Immunity,” a New Zealand sitcom.

In film, he is well-known to Lord of the Rings fans as the elf Haldir of Lorien from The Fellowship of the Ring and The Two Towers and also was the voice of Gothmog (Third Age) in The Return of the King. He recently appeared in Underworld: Rise of the Lycans.
